“Bible School Changed Me and My Community”: Natalia’s Experience from Dnipro

Natalia from Dnipro was baptized back in 2001. She came to the church thanks to literary evangelism: the books that fell into her hands opened the way to God. Since then, missionary work has become a part of her life.

When the Bible School appeared, Natalia accidentally saw an advertisement on the Internet. She admits that at the time it seemed too complicated: "I thought it was some kind of classroom, digital evangelism, which I don't understand anything about. Let others do it."

But conversations about the school in the community became more frequent. Finally, Natalia dared to try. “And I was surprised at how simple and clear everything was. Nothing complicated!” she recalls.

In October 2021, she became a teacher at the “Bible School.” And by December, she had 15 students.

Natalia began sharing her experience in church: every Saturday she showed videos, encouraged people to join, and prayed together for development. The result was not long in coming: the number of teachers began to grow, and today there are already nine of them.

Later, they created a group on Telegram. At first, there were only members of the community, then brothers and sisters from Kryvyi Rih joined, and then those who had gone abroad - to Germany, the USA. Today, the group covers many different cities. Every Monday, they meet online: they pray, share experiences, discuss difficulties, and support each other.

During her ministry, about a hundred students passed through Natalia. Some were limited to one lesson, some took a whole course or several. A total of 57 people began their studies, 31 completed at least one course, and three were baptized. There are also those who now attend church.

Natalia's family also joined the study: her sister, niece, nephew, and aunt, who belongs to another church. "The Lord touches hearts in different ways," she shares.

Today, Natalia looks back with gratitude: "Honestly, I never thought I would be able to do this. But the Lord opened the door and gave me strength. And I see that His blessings are limitless." The Bible School, which is an integral part of the Nadiya Media Group, has become for Natalia not only a ministry, but also a path to new opportunities from God.
